Common HVAC repair issues in Deer Valley homes
Here are the most frequent failures technicians diagnose locally, with typical causes and signs to watch for.
- Compressor failure
- Causes: age, overheating from blocked airflow or dirty coils, electrical faults, low refrigerant
- Signs: system not cooling, loud humming or grinding from the outdoor unit, frequent short cycling
- Blower motor problems
- Causes: worn bearings, capacitor failure, excessive dust in the blower wheel
- Signs: weak airflow from vents, unusual noise from the furnace/air handler, inconsistent room temperatures
- Refrigerant leaks
- Causes: corrosion, vibration stress on refrigerant lines, manufacturing defects
- Signs: decreased cooling performance, ice on evaporator coil, higher energy use, hissing sounds near lines
- Ignition and furnace issues
- Causes: dirty or failing ignitors, blocked flues, faulty gas valves
- Signs: furnace won’t light, frequent pilot outages, unusual odours, system locking out
- Control and thermostat failures
- Causes: wiring damage, failed control boards, incompatible thermostat settings
- Signs: system not responding to thermostat, incorrect cycling, settings ignored
- Condenser and coil contamination
- Causes: desert dust, debris after storms, nearby landscaping
- Signs: reduced cooling efficiency, higher operating pressures, longer run times
What a professional HVAC diagnostic includes
A thorough diagnostic is the foundation of an accurate repair. Expect a step-by-step inspection that covers:
- Visual and audible inspection of indoor and outdoor units for damage and debris
- Measurement of refrigerant pressures and temperatures to detect leaks or charge issues
- Electrical testing of capacitors, contactors, motors, and control boards
- Airflow assessment across the evaporator coil and supply registers
- Thermostat and control system verification
- Combustion and venting checks for gas-fired equipment when applicable
Technicians should explain findings in plain language, show the failed components when practical, and present options for repair or replacement based on measured data.
Typical repair procedures and what they include
Repairs are performed to restore safe, efficient operation and often include:
- Replacing failed compressors, motors, or fan assemblies
- Repairing refrigerant leaks and recharging to manufacturer specifications
- Replacing capacitors, contactors, ignitors, and control boards
- Cleaning or straightening condenser and evaporator coils
- Restoring proper airflow by cleaning blower wheels and replacing filters
- Securing and insulating refrigerant lines, and repairing duct connections
Quality repairs use correctly sized parts and follow manufacturer procedures. Expect technicians to retest system performance after repairs to confirm normal pressures, temperatures, and airflow.

When to repair versus replace in Deer Valley
Deciding between repair and replacement depends on several practical factors:
- Age of the system
- Systems older than 12 to 15 years are often less efficient and more prone to repeated breakdowns
- Cost of the repair relative to replacement
- If repair costs approach 50 percent or more of a new system, replacement is usually more cost effective
- Frequency of repairs
- Multiple repairs within a short period indicate impending failure and decreased reliability
- Efficiency and comfort needs
- Newer units provide better SEER ratings, improved humidity control, and quieter operation—important in the Deer Valley climate
- Safety concerns
- Significant furnace or combustion system issues may require replacement for safety and code compliance
A professional diagnostic should provide an honest assessment with estimated costs and expected remaining life to guide the decision.
Preventive steps to reduce future repairs
Regular maintenance dramatically reduces emergency repairs in Deer Valley. Effective steps include:
- Seasonal tune-ups before peak cooling and heating seasons
- Frequent filter changes to limit dust and protect coils
- Regular coil and condenser cleaning, especially after monsoon storms
- Annual safety checks for gas and heat systems
- Enrolling in a maintenance plan to catch small issues early
Preventive care lowers energy bills, improves comfort, and extends equipment life.
